Get PriceJan 7 2022628 Effect of impurities The presence of impurities in a system can have a profound effect on the growth of a crystal Some impurities can suppress growth entirely some may enhance growth while others may exert a highly selective effect acting only on certain crystallographic faces and thus modifying the crystal habit see section

Get PriceThe variation in cold crushing strength is as a result of variation in their chemical composition For Alumina refractories as the alumina content increases the cold crushing strength also increases The absence of oxide impurities Fe2O3 and CaO and the addition of Cr2O3 can double the cold crushing strength
Get PriceThe effect of impurities on the critical interaction strength for the Mott transition has been investigated using an extension of the Gutzwiller approach to correlation in the metallic state It is shown that the band narrowing due to impurities causes a reduction of the effective interaction necessary for the transition to the insulating state
